Oregon Foreclosure is Non-Judicial
Oregon foreclosure law states that…
1. Sending the Notice of Default out for recording and setting a sale date. (Must record Notice of Default, mail and serve Notice of Sale on occupants more than 120 days before the sale date).
2. Publication – 4 consecutive weeks, the last publication must be more than 20 days before the sale date.
3. Oregon foreclosure sale date is set no earlier than 120 days from the Notice of Default.
4. The sale must be conducted between 9 a.m. and 4 p.m. at a place designated in the notice
5. Occupant of premises has 10 days after sale to vacate premises.
6. Sale can be continued up to 180 days (in case of Bankruptcy filing, sale continued indefinitely).
7. A deficiency judgment cannot be obtained through a non-judicial deed of trust foreclosure by advertisement.
